MPS650G Equivalent & Substitute Parts
Part Overview
The MPS650G is an NPN bipolar junction transistor manufactured by onsemi, rated for 40 V collector-emitter breakdown voltage and 2 A maximum collector current. This device is packaged in a TO-92 (TO-226-3) through-hole configuration and is designed for general-purpose switching and amplification applications with a maximum power dissipation of 625 mW.
The MPS650G is classified as obsolete. Identifying equivalent and substitute parts is necessary to maintain design continuity, ensure supply chain availability, and support ongoing production or repair requirements for systems utilizing this component.

Substitute Part Grouping Explanation
Substitution of the MPS650G is determined by the following critical parameters:
Electrical Compatibility Requirements:
- Transistor type must be NPN
- Maximum collector current must be greater than or equal to 2 A
- Collector-emitter breakdown voltage must be greater than or equal to 40 V
- Maximum power dissipation must be greater than or equal to 625 mW
- Operating temperature range must encompass or exceed -55°C to 150°C
Mechanical Compatibility Requirements:
- Mounting type must be through-hole
- Package must be physically compatible with TO-92 footprint or designated as TO-92 compatible
The ZTX690B meets these substitution criteria. It is an NPN transistor with 2 A maximum collector current, 45 V collector-emitter breakdown voltage, 1 W maximum power dissipation, and through-hole E-Line packaging that is designated as TO-92 compatible. The ZTX690B exceeds the electrical specifications of the MPS650G while maintaining mechanical compatibility.

Engineering Selection Recommendations
Product Status Consideration: The MPS650G is classified as obsolete, while the ZTX690B is active. For new designs or ongoing production requiring component replenishment, the ZTX690B is the appropriate selection due to its active product status and continued availability.
Compliance and Certification: The ZTX690B holds RoHS3 compliance certification, whereas the MPS650G does not specify RoHS compliance. Both devices are REACH unaffected and carry EAR99 ECCN classification. For applications subject to RoHS requirements, the ZTX690B provides regulatory alignment.
Electrical Performance: The ZTX690B provides superior electrical performance across multiple parameters: 5 V higher collector-emitter breakdown voltage, 375 mW additional power dissipation capacity, and 75 MHz higher transition frequency. These enhancements provide design margin and improved performance characteristics without compromising the core 2 A collector current specification.
Mechanical Compatibility: The ZTX690B E-Line package is designated as TO-92 compatible, enabling direct footprint substitution in existing through-hole designs without PCB modification.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: Can the ZTX690B directly replace the MPS650G in existing designs?
A: Yes. The ZTX690B meets all minimum electrical requirements of the MPS650G (2 A collector current, 40 V minimum breakdown voltage, 625 mW minimum power dissipation) and is packaged in a TO-92 compatible configuration. Direct substitution is electrically and mechanically valid.
Q: What are the key differences between these two transistors?
A: The ZTX690B exceeds the MPS650G in collector-emitter breakdown voltage (45 V vs. 40 V), maximum power dissipation (1 W vs. 625 mW), transition frequency (150 MHz vs. 75 MHz), and maximum operating temperature (200°C vs. 150°C). Both devices share identical 2 A collector current ratings and 100 nA collector cutoff current specifications.
Q: Are there any package considerations for substitution?
A: The MPS650G uses a TO-92-3 package, while the ZTX690B uses an E-Line-3 package. Both are through-hole configurations with TO-92 compatible pinouts. Physical dimensions may vary slightly, but standard TO-92 footprints accommodate both packages without PCB redesign.
Q: Does the ZTX690B require any circuit modifications when substituting for the MPS650G?
A: No circuit modifications are required. The ZTX690B is a direct electrical substitute with superior specifications. Existing bias networks, load resistances, and circuit topologies designed for the MPS650G operate without adjustment.
Q: What is the significance of the higher transition frequency in the ZTX690B?
A: The ZTX690B transition frequency of 150 MHz, compared to the MPS650G at 75 MHz, indicates improved high-frequency performance. This provides additional design margin for switching applications and enables operation at higher switching frequencies without performance degradation.
Q: Are both devices suitable for the same temperature range applications?
A: The MPS650G operates from -55°C to 150°C, while the ZTX690B operates from -55°C to 200°C. For applications requiring operation above 150°C, only the ZTX690B is suitable. For applications within the -55°C to 150°C range, both devices are compatible.
Q: What compliance advantages does the ZTX690B offer?
A: The ZTX690B is RoHS3 compliant, providing regulatory alignment for applications subject to RoHS directives. The MPS650G does not specify RoHS compliance. Both devices are REACH unaffected.
